WHAT YOU WILL ACCOMPLISH
The Night Auditor acts as the Resort's Manager on Duty during overnight hours, overseeing resort operations including Front Office, Night Audit, and Safety/Security. This role ensures operational continuity, financial accuracy, and exceptional guest service overnight.
Key responsibilities include:
Supervise all overnight resort operations, providing leadership across departments including Front Desk, Bell/Valet, Engineering, and Food & Beverage.
Lead and support Front Office team members through coaching, training, and performance feedback.
Oversee guest service standards for check-in/out, reservations, billing, and special requests.
Manage Night Audit duties: reconcile revenue, verify billing accuracy, balance ledgers, and complete end-of-day reports.
Respond to emergencies and security concerns; coordinate with appropriate departments to ensure guest and staff safety.
Resolve guest complaints and proactively address operational issues.
Promote hotel services to maximize occupancy and revenue.
Maintain current knowledge of hotel offerings, local area, and policies.
WHAT YOU WILL BRING
High school diploma or equivalent; Bachelor's in Hospitality Management preferred.
3+ years of Front Office experience, including 1 year in a leadership role.
Strong knowledge of accounting practices, guest service protocols, and hotel systems.
Excellent communication, conflict resolution, and problem-solving skills.
Proficiency in Microsoft Office and hotel property management systems.
Ability to work independently and manage multiple priorities under pressure.
